.header--read {
    margin: 0 0 15px 0;
    padding: 0 7%;
    font-family: 'RobotoLight', sans-serif;
    font-size: 24px;
    text-align: center;
}

.col-read:nth-child(odd) {
    padding: 0 7px 0 0;
}

.col-read:nth-child(even) {
    padding: 0 0 0 7px;
}

.read-item {
    position: relative;
    margin: 0 0 7px;
    overflow: hidden;
}

.read-item__img {
    width: 100%;
}

.read-item__desc {
    position: absolute;
    width: 100%;
    top: 80%;
    left: 4%;
}

.read-item__actions {
    width: 37%;
}

.read-item__label {
    min-width: 75px;
    width: 100%;
    padding: 5px 8%;
    font-size: 10px;
}

@media only screen and (min-width:480px) {
    .read-item__desc {
        top: 85%;
        left: 5%;
    }

    .read-item__label {
        font-size: 13px;
    }

}

@media only screen and (min-width:520px) {
    .col-read:nth-child(odd) {
        padding: 0 15px 0 0;
    }

    .col-read:nth-child(even) {
        padding: 0 0 0 15px;
    }

    .header--read {
        margin: 0 0 30px 0;
        padding: 0 11%;
        font-size: 35px;
    }

    .read-item {
        margin: 0 0 26px;
    }

    .read-item__label {
        padding: 10px 8%;
    }
}

